Fangs N Feathers is a premier interactive reptile experience that offers you the chance to get hands-on with a selection of amazing animals!
Meet Bob the Blue-tongue Skink, Pearl the Tortoise, Florence the Kingsnake and many more. Learn all about them - where they're from, what they eat and why reptiles are an important part of our planets ecosystem.
